  • Where are the optical cables for power transmission lines located

    Where are the optical cables for power transmission lines located

    OPAC (optical power attached cable) is a type of fiber optic cable that is installed by attaching to a host conductor along overhead power lines. TBC extends from the cities of Pittsburg, CA to San Francisco, CA, and provides approximately 40% of the electrical power used on a. Electrical utilities have several cables available for their use on transmission towers and poles. Besides traditional cables lashed to messengers, figure-8 cables or ADSS cables, utilities can construct transmission links using optical ground wire (OPGW) or optical power phase conductor (OPPC). OPGW is made like a regular conductive wire, but in the center of the wire there is a hollow tube with some optical fibers inside. It is used as a shield for power conductors. The main function is to place the optical fiber in the ground wire of the overhead high-voltage transmission line to form the OPGW optical fiber communication network on the transmission line.
